Did Mikey Way And Gerard Way's Relationship Impact My Chemical Romance's Comeback?

It doesn't appear that My Chemical Romance's comeback was affected by the relationship between Mikey Way and Gerard Way. In truth, they have always looked as if it would get alongside smartly. It sounds like the band was excited to accomplish in combination once more.

My Chemical Romance's historical past is interesting as a result of they've damaged up and gotten again in combination a couple of times. They determined to forestall performing and taking part in together in 2013. The band then were given back together to perform in Los Angeles in 2019.

Whenever My Chemical Romance has damaged up, Mikey Way and Gerard Way were fair about how they had been feeling at the time.

In 2019, Gerard Way spoke to The Guardian about the band breaking up in 2013. He mentioned, “It wasn’t a laugh to make stuff any longer. I think breaking up the band broke us out of that machine.”

Gerard additionally mentioned that it was arduous to reach such a lot luck as a result of people would all the time inform them what they must do. It seems like he felt like he wasn't ready to do what he really wanted. He mentioned in his interview with The Guardian, "When things begin to prevail and cross actually neatly, that’s when a large number of other people start to have an opinion and that’s when you run into struggle.”

He explained that when My Chemical Romance put out their third album, "The Black Parade," in 2006, that was a challenging time. He told The Guardian, “everybody had a f*cking opinion about what MCR should be. So it made it difficult to figure out what direction to take next. You get caught up in this trap of ‘Is it ever gonna be good enough?’”

While My Chemical Romance put off their comeback tour because of the pandemic, this wasn't the first time that the band went through some major changes. In 2007, Mikey Way quit My Chemical Romance and said that he needed to focus on his personal life.

According to The Guardian, Mikey was interested in being at home with his first wife, Alicia Simmons, instead of touring and performing all the time.

Gerard Way shared the news with the band's fans and said, "I'm very proud to announce my brother's contemporary marriage. Watching him grow up into a person and finding love makes me the happiest brother alive. In gentle of this joyous match, the band has decided to give he and his wife a far needed break from the highway to begin a lifestyles and have a correct honeymoon and do all of the issues a newlywed couple will have to do."

While that marriage didn't last and Mikey married his second wife Kristin Blanford in 2016, Gerard's statement suggests that he and his brother Mikey Way get along. Gerard seemed to understand what Mikey needed at that time in his life and was very caring toward him.

In 2011, the brothers were interviewed by Kerrang! Magazine, and they talked about their relationship. It doesn't seem that they have ever had any trouble. They said that they originally wanted to call the band My Chemical Brothers, which is definitely proof of their love for each other.

Gerard mentioned, "Mikey's always got my back. He's one in every of the maximum supportive other folks in my existence alongside my wife. Anything I wish to do, he is there for me: from operating on a drawing as a child, to what we do now. And I've always attempted to be there for him. Knowing there may be any person out there who has so much consider in what you do is superb." He also said during the interview, "If my brother hadn't been in this band when I started it, I have no idea if I'd have were given thru all of it."

Mikey told the publication, "He's my highest buddy and he understands me like no person else on earth."
